MEMBERS of the Interact Club from Queen Elizabeth Sixth Form College and Darlington Rotary Club came together to say thank you and goodbye to outgoing Interact Club President and Vice President, Danny Brown and Gina Bibby.

The pair have spearheaded a number of projects including organising an Easter egg collection for the local women’s refuge and collecting more than £900 worth of goods for the British Heart Foundation. Nancy Wall, co-Ordinator of the Darlington college’s Interact Club, said: "Danny, Gina and all of the members of the Interact Club have worked ever so hard this year to make a real, lasting difference to the community.

"Staff and students have fully supported their projects and their dedication to the Club has been outstanding, they should be extremely proud of themselves."

Rotary Club president, Paul Robinson, Vice President, Mike Challands, Interact Co-Ordinator, Roly Lang, and and college Vice Principal, Laurence Job,came together to honour the students.

The new President and Vice President for the next year will be Lancia Lee-Deckard and Tom Makepeace, begin their tenure this September.
